This simple function [f_approx,f,Aeq,beq,Aineq,bineq]=quadaprox_CPLEX(x,xmax,Y) return the matrices Aeq,beq,Aineq,bineq for formulate a MILP of a Piecewise Linearization Aproximation of a Quadratic function f(x)=x^2, the approximated value f_approx (with CPLEX for MATLAB) and the real value f genereted by x, where xmax is the considered maximum value of x and Y is the number of evaluated pieces.

The MILP formulation is showned in the Image.

If you don’t use CPLEX to solve MILP then use the function [Aeq,beq,Aineq,bineq]=quadaprox(P,Pmax,Y), but it won’t compute the approximated value.
